lean over the railing
US /liːn ˈoʊ.vɚ ðə ˈreɪ.lɪŋ/
UK /liːn ˈəʊ.və ðə ˈreɪ.lɪŋ/
Phrase
to bend one's body forward or sideways over a protective barrier or fence
Example:
•
Don't lean over the railing too far or you might fall.
•
She had to lean over the railing to see the boat below.
